Self-Programming

In the years prior to the 21st Century the technology for car keys changed from mechanical keys and became a mix of physical and electronic protocols to stop theft. Many of these new keys have a microchip integrated into them that needs to be programmed in order to connect it to your vehicle's electronics system. The best way to reprogram your car keys is with an experienced locksmith who has access the appropriate equipment. A lot of vehicles, especially high-end ones, allow only dealers to make new keys.

The process for doing this on your own is different from manufacturer to manufacturer. In general, you will need to put the spare key into the ignition and then manipulate it (according to the directions in your owner’s manual) until the car enters the programming mode. It only takes a few moments before your car leaves the programming mode.

You'll have repeat this process for each key you would like to program after your car is in programming mode. The instructions contained in the owner's manual are specific to the type of key fob programing near me and model that you are trying to program, since some models come with additional security features that require to be enabled (for instance a passcode required to access certain programming modes).

Certain models of cars require an additional code that can only be obtained from the dealer at a cost to you. This code protects against "skimming" which occurs when a thief tries to read the information on your key via the OBD2 ports in order to steal the car.

Key Programmers

You might wonder if it's possible to reprogram your key in case you've lost them or are replacing them. It depends on the car manufacturer, but in the majority of instances you'll need collaborate with an auto car key programmer near me locksmith or dealer to program the new key into the vehicle. This requires reprogramming the new key's transponder so that it matches the settings of the car that was originally programmed.

Certain cars let you do it yourself, however the majority require a professional or dealer to utilize a tool that is able to connect to the vehicle and read programming data from the ECU. The key is then reprogrammed to ensure that it is compatible with the car's specifications and it can be used as a regular key.

There are a variety of car key programmers. Some are specific to specific models and makes and others are universal and can be used with a wide range of vehicles. Most of these tools have a tiny screen and several buttons that you press to enter the programming mode. Then, connect the device to an OBD-II connector to read and programming the new key.

Professionals can program a new car key in only a few minutes, however certain vehicles require longer and complicated methods to reprogram keys correctly. For instance, some modern vehicles require a particular code that only the car dealer is able to access and use to access the immobilizer's systems. In these cases it is best to leave the task to an expert so that you don't cause damage to the system and end up with no means to start your car.

Key Fobs

Modern-day key fobs offer a host of security and convenience benefits. They can be used to replace or augment traditional keys for cars and control more than just locking doors; they can start the engine, activate the alarm and perform various other functions.

The key reprogramming near me fob makes use of radio signals to communicate with a receiver in the vehicle. When you hit a button on the key fob key programming (visit site), it will send a code to the receiver, which then responds by performing the desired function. Key fobs are also popular with commercial building owners who can integrate them into a larger access control system. This allows them monitor who is allowed in or out, and block fobs which have been lost or stolen.

As with any other electronic device, key fobs can fail at times. Because they are constantly tossed around in pockets and purses, they can become damaged or lose their signal. Although they're built to endure a lot, they are not impervious to damage; after all, they're little more than metal and plastic.

If your key fobs are not working, you may need to replace the battery. Use the correct battery and refer to your owner's manual to find out how to replace it correctly. Also, ensure that you follow any additional steps for reprogramming or recalibration that might apply.

Wear and tear is a common cause of failing fobs. As they are continually dropped, bumped into things, and jostled about in pocket and purses, they can become worn down or even cracked. Oftentimes, a quick and inexpensive fix is all that's needed to get your key fobs running.

Keyless Entry

Keyless entry allows you to unlock your car and begin it without needing to insert physical keys. It makes use of a wireless signal to connect with the car's internal system, and it can also allow you to control various features within the vehicle including climate controls or music systems.

Modern keyless entry systems utilize rolling code technology to safeguard against security breaches. It's important to note that even this technology isn't perfect. A burglar could employ a technique referred to as "replay attack" to send a message that is recorded by the car's receiver. Once this message is recorded an intruder device could retransmit the same transmission to the car's receiver and gain access to the protected property.

Depending on the make and model of your vehicle, you may be able to program new keys on your own or you may have to employ an automotive locksmith key fob programming near me to do it. Certain car manufacturers have an onboard program that is specifically designed and others require you have an advanced programmer attached to the OBD2 connector.

The most commonly used method to program new keys for cars is to place the key fob in the ignition and turn it on in a specific sequence. This puts the car in the "programming mode," and once it is, one or more fob buttons will be pressed to transmit the digital identification code to the car's computer. The computer then stores this code and then takes the car out of programming mode.

Certain manufacturers require that you have a special advanced programer to program key fobs. These are expensive and are difficult to use for the common person. It is recommended to delegate the work to an automotive locksmith or dealer.

To begin programming for a car with keyless entry begin by stepping into your vehicle from the driver's seat and close all the doors, with the exception of the driver's. This will stop the system from locking your doors while you attempt to program the key. Press and hold the button of the fob you wish to activate when the ignition is turned on and the other keys you wish to be to program are nearby. The hazard light will flash twice.
